Abstract

This paper introduces a kind of new homemade and low cost multi-channel nucleic acid pyrosequence detector for at least ninety-six channels and presents the detail of related software and hardware development. We construct a kind of automatic instrument to fulfill the pyrosequencing processes. First we select the X-86 personal computer as host computer, the AT89C51 micro-controller as slave computer, the PMT (photoelectric multiply tube) as photoelectric transformation equipment, and the HY-6022 as data sampling device; Second we use the Visual C++ 6.0 as coding tools to design the measure and control system based on Windows 2000 operating system; Third we sample the fluorescent signal in all of the cuvettes during the reaction between nucleic acid and reagent; Last we analyze these data to realize the function of the multi-channel nucleic acid detection. In this paper the whole instrument design and key parts design are both introduced such as the liquid injection process and related structure design, the communication module between the host personal computer and the MCS51, the high sensitivity multi-channel detector (at least 96 channels, the sensitivity is 2.45×10-9w) etc. The result of the instrument for two channels data processing is also reported in this paper.
